Kelling Heath. Set amongst 250 acres of woodland and rare open heathland in an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, Kelling Heath is also very close to the North Norfolk coastline at Weybourne. We have miles of woodland and heathland trails for walking and cycling, or simply enjoying the diverse range of wildlife and the many species of birds. Kelling Heath also offers a range of recreational and leisure facilities including indoor and outdoor pools and tennis courts.
Kelling Heath is unique amongst the holiday parks of Britain. We have our own Countryside Team dedicated to caring for our very special natural environment, and related activities for our guests to enjoy.
